Celebrate Canada’s 150th Birthday With This DIY “O Canada” Banner

If you follow me on Instagram, you know that I was born and raised in Alaska, roughly two hours from the Canadian border. It’s funny growing up there, because it always feels like Canada is a part of you (like, you refer to the continental United States as “the Outside” but Canada is “next door”). Growing up, we often hosted high schools from Canada at sporting events or cultural activites. So much so, that basically everyone in Alaska knows both of the national anthems of the two countries. I sang “The Star Spangled Banner” and “O Canada” before many a high school basketball game and, to this day, I still know both by heart. So when I realized that my “other homeland” was going to be celebrating their 150th birthday – I immediately wanted to do a little something to embrace those memories of singing their gorgeous anthem. So, I busted out my trusty Cricut Explore Air and made a fun, glittery banner! Check out my step by step tutorial on how to celebrate Canada’s 150th birthday with this DIY “O Canada” banner!

Some Tips And Suggestions For Traveling With A Toddler

Over Christmas, we flew round-trip from Austin, Texas to Anchorage, Alaska – and then drove from there to Salcha (and back!). As many of you know, I was born and raised in Alaska and we visit go there to visit my family for Christmas once every two years. This was our first time flying with a toddler (she was 5 months old the last time we did this trip) and I was also several months pregnant. Overall, Melanie did really great during each of our four flights plus the two eight+ hour car rides but I did figure out some tips and suggestions for traveling with a toddler and I’m sharing them with you!

5 Reasons a Stroller Is A Must When You Travel with Babies or Toddlers

When I was pregnant with my first child, I wasn’t 100% sure if I needed a stroller or not. Honestly, I was leaning toward not since our house and car is very small (no storage for a large stroller even if it was collapsible), we live in a rural neighborhood with no sidewalks or trails for walking, and everywhere we go has shopping baskets. A stroller really felt like an extra that we didn’t need. Then, I started thinking. We knew that we’d be traveling a lot in the first few years of her life and that involved long, multi-leg plane rides… and that meant we really should invest in a stroller to make it through airport terminals. And you know what? I am SO GLAD we made that decision! Trying to travel or vacation with a baby or a toddler (though little buggers can RUN) without a stroller is like trying to make a hole in a brick wall using just your head – it’s really, really hard and you’re making things more difficult than they need to be. Don’t believe me? Here’s my 5 reasons a stroller is a must when you travel with babies or toddlers!
